Have you installed sub surface drainage in Impermeable clay sub soils?If so your ground will greatly benefit from mole ploughing. WD drainage has invested in a new plough for any of its customers to use free of charge. With 200mm plus of rain touching the ground in October, it has highlighted the need and benefit of mole ploughing, helping get the excess water moving and off the paddock much quicker.
